Temperature Input Terminals Section 4-9
The following diagram shows how temperature data is divided and the data
configuration.
Leftmost/rightmost bit: Determines whether leftmost or rightmost digits are
displayed.
Temperature unit bit: Determines whether temperature is expressed in
°C
or
°F.
Broken wire bit: Turns ON (1) to notify of broken wire. At that time the
data in the leftmost three digits is “7FF” and the data
in the rightmost three digits is “FFF.
The three leftmost digits and three rightmost digits, each comprising one word
of data, are alternately provided to the Master every 125 ms as shown in the
following diagram.
Temperature data (Actual temperature x 100, in binary data)
Notification format for leftmost 3 digits
Notification format for rightmost 3 digits
